### sec.21 Application for prospecting permit
An application for a prospecting permit for land must—
be made in the approved form and lodged with the chief executive; and
be accompanied by—
proof, to the chief executive’s satisfaction, of the applicant’s identity; and
the fee prescribed under a regulation; and
state the applicant’s name, and address for service of notices; and
if the application is for a parcel prospecting permit—
identify, by sketch and description, or in another way acceptable to the chief executive, the land over which the permit is sought and land proposed to be used as access; and
state the name and address of each owner of occupied land over which the permit is sought; and
state the name and address of each owner of land proposed to be used as access.
s 21 ins 1995 No. 21 s 9
amd 2000 No. 64 s 64 ; 2012 No. 20 s 281 sch 2 ; 2013 No. 10 s 193 sch 1
